The National Monuments Service's description

Carrigan (1905, 2, 371) records a chimney-piece removed from Tubbrid castle (KK013-033001-) bearing the date 1596 in relief as being located in, 'an unoccupied house, on the roadside, opposite Tubrid church'. located in a roadside house. The only house indicated on the 1st (1839) ed. OS 6-inch map and 1900 revision is located c. 140m NNE of Tubbrid church. When inspected in 1987 the chimney-piece was concealed behind a modern fireplace. The lintel has subsequently been returned to the castle (c. 2016) and has restored to the third-floor fireplace.
